** News on H-1B Visa
------------------------------------------------------------
The White House’s proclamation on H-1B went into effect on Sunday, September 21, 2025, which would require individuals who filed their initial H-1B application after the effect date to pay $100,000 before they are granted entry into the U.S. This news is still developing, including how the new fee will be imposed. ** 2025 SUCCESS Convening Recap
------------------------------------------------------------
[link removed]
On September 10-12, 2025, we proudly cohosted the SUCCESS Convening for a third time! This year, we gathered at the University of Illinois Chicago with more than 450 individuals from over 135 institutions and 65 organizations across 30+ states. Read more from our event recap ([link removed]) !
